From article <90235.203843SAAAA02@cc1.kuleuven.ac.be>, by SAAAA02@BLEKUL11.BITNET: > Is there anybody who could explain me the following algorithms in > brief : Data Compression with Sliding Dictionaries with Multiple > Shannon-Fano trees ? PKZIP uses both of these. Phil Katz lists the following references in the package documentation: Storer, James A. "Data Compression, Methods and Theory" Computer Science Press, 1988 Held, Gilbert "Data Compression, Techniques and Applications" John Wiley and Sons, 1987
